BookMacster - Cross-Browser Bookmarks Syncer and Manager
Oct 12, 2010 - Sheep Systems announced today that BookMacster has passed final testing with the release of version 1.2. This version supports automatic cross-browser bookmarks synchronization via the user's choice of file-syncing services in the cloud. It also rounds out BookMacster's web-browser support by adding iCab and Pinboard. BookMacster supports tags, comments, and shortcuts. BookMacster users can add bookmarks directly from within browsers, and access all bookmarks while in any app from the menu bar.

Five Dollar iPad Stand Created To Raise Money For Charitable Causes
Oct 12, 2010 - Tim Piazza's iPad stand is a simple easel that holds the iPad upright on a flat surface. Tim created this inexpensive iPad stand from corrugated plastic to raise money for charities. Available in black, silver and white, the stands are sold through his Ezzyl website and the customer can choose a charity for 20% of the proceeds to be donated to. Piazza selected charities based on their strong ratings and global reach, and feels by giving buyers a choice, they participate in the giving.

IntelliScanner SOHO - Smart Barcode Scanner For Small Business
Oct 12, 2010 - IntelliScanner Corporation today launched the IntelliScanner SOHO 150. IntelliScanner SOHO makes it easy for small businesses to keep track of business inventory and assets with barcode technology. By simply scanning the barcode, users can automatically create a comprehensive inventory of what's in stock, where it is, and what they have invested. IntelliScanner's included software package provide detailed reports, notifies when stock is running low, and totals the value of current inventory.

Electric Pocket Releases Major Update to MailTones for iPhone
Oct 12, 2010 - Electric Pocket today announces MailTones 1.4 for iOS, enabling iPhone users to change the email alert tone and set different tones for email messages, based on info about the sender or message subject. It enables users to distinguish high priority emails from their boss or spouse or receive custom "pager style" alerts to messages which require immediate attention. Version 1.4 offers more tones to choose from and a polished, more professional look with full support for retina screen displays.
HexaLex 2.3 Adds Game Center Support and Retina Display Graphics
Oct 12, 2010 - Independent iPhone developer Nathan Gray today released HexaLex 2.3 for iOS, adding support for Game Center leaderboards and achievements to the hit crossword game. Played with hexagonal tiles, HexaLex allows players to form words in three directions rather than just two, bringing new gameplay possibilities and challenges. The update also includes crisp Retina Display graphics, adds user-requested features and improves stability.
